- Provide high-quality nursing care to patients in the Pre-Op department.
- Adhere to all nursing standards, policies, and procedures to ensure patient safety and satisfaction.
- Collaborate with the interdisciplinary team to develop and implement individualized patient care plans.
- Monitor and assess patient's physical and emotional well-being before surgery.
- Administer medications and treatments as prescribed by physicians.
- Educate patients and their families about the surgical process and post-operative care.
- Prepare patients for surgery by assisting with pre-operative procedures and ensuring all necessary equipment and supplies are available.
- Document patient information accurately and timely in electronic medical records.
- Communicate effectively with patients, families, and healthcare team members.
- Advocate for patient needs and serve as a patient advocate.

Bachelor's Degree In Nursing (Bsn) From An Accredited Institution.
Current And Valid Registered Nurse (Rn) License In The State Of Georgia.
Minimum Of 2 Years Experience In A Pre-Operative Setting.
Bls And Acls Certification From The American Heart Association.

A private, not-for-profit organization with 800 locations serving 2.5 million patients across Georgia, Piedmont is transforming healthcare, creating a destination known for the best clinicians and a one-of-a-kind experience that always puts patients first. Today, more than 110 years since it was founded, Piedmont is known as a leading health system in treatment of heart disease, organ transplantation and cancer care with 11 hospitals, 27 urgent care centers, 28 Piedmont QuickCare locations, 555 Piedmont Clinic physician practice locations and more than 2,300 Piedmont Clinic members.
